Firstly I would like to thank the NHS and Inclusion for all the support, and Key Workers for all their help. I think it helps a lot of people, but not all. You can not win them all, its down to the individuals willpower to beat their addiction. I went to Farlington for a Detox for ten days and I met a lot of good people and some of the stories I heard were heartbreaking. In my opinion a lot of people there were helped and hopefully will go on to sort themselves out to get on with their lives. The counsellors and staff were great. At New Milton I found uncomfortable talking in front of a group of strangers about personal problems, some people find it intimidating and are put off from attending. Possible one to one with a Key Worker would suit some people better. Although I know you have limited resources. But overall I think Inclusion helps a lot of people. I would like to thank Jason and Tina who is a rock and deserves a promotion and pay rise immediately. I am not out of the woods yet but I can see the trees.
